The Discmania MD1 (5/6/0/0) and Latitude 64 Fuse (5/6/-1/0) are both midranges, and they fly very similarly.

How they compare

Both are speed 5, so neither needs more power than the other to reach its flight. The MD1 is the more overstable of the two (stability 0 vs -1), so it fights wind and finishes harder to the left, while the Fuse flies straighter or turns more. Both land at a similar estimated maximum distance (about 89 m).

Which should you choose?

Choose the MD1 when you need to fight wind, throw forehand, or want a dependable finishing hook. Reach for the Fuse when you want a straighter line, an easier turnover, or more help at a lower arm speed.
